Schibsted and FINN ready for JavaZone

“The JavaZone conference is a great place to meet some of the brightest minds in the business,” says Rafik Laatiaoui, Technical Recruiter at Schibsted Products & Technology.

JavaZone is a conference for Java developers created by the Norwegian Java User Group: javaBin. The conference have existed since 2001, and nowadays consists of around 200 speakers and seven parallel tracks over two days.
